dc.description.abstractPhosphate rocks are important in different industries as those of phosphoric acid and fertilizer. This study was carried out to test the solubility of Partially Acidulated Phosphate Rock (PAPR) from eastern part of Nuba Mountains area, namely J.Kurun. Colorimetric techniques were used for determination of the solubility in water, neutral ammonium citrate (NAC) and 2% citric acid (CA) at 200?, 400? and 600?. The water-soluble P2O5 of PAPRs of partial acidulation at same temperatures were ranged between 1.40%and 44%. NAC soluble P2O5, of3% H2SO4were ranged between (0.56%and 2.80%. The 2% citric acid soluble of PAPRs sample were ranged between 8.00%and 20.70%en_US
